Does anyone know anything about G. Paul Bishop, a portrait photographer in Berkeley, California who died in 1998, or his son, G. Paul Bishop, Jr., who seems to have inherited his studio and rights to his photographs? I'm trying to help someone acquire rights to a photograph taken by the elder Bishop in the 1970s, and they have a website at http://www.gpaulbishop.com/ , suggesting that this is possible, but they don't seem to answer e-mails or phone calls, and my colleague says they have been trying for three months.

Anyone who lives in Berkeley know, if the studio at 2125 Durant Avenue is still operating? If I googlemap it and look at the street view, the studio seems to be there (or at least it was when the Googlemap car drove by), attached to a house, where Mr. Bishop, Jr. may live, I suspect.
